How Comedy Travels on Netflix
Netflix licenses films globally and produces originals, so which comedies appear depends on your country and subscription. Catalog titles from major studios rotate more slowly than Netflix originals, which means broadly appealing comedies tend to persist even as individual shows come and go. Regional originals may not be available abroad, but many smart, cross-regional picks remain consistent year-round. When you sort by Top Comedy, you are mostly seeing proven audience favorites and algorithmic hits rather than fleeting viral moments.
Genre Comedy That Ages Well
Certain subgenres of comedy hold up especially well over time, including workplace satire, family dynamics humor, and clever spoofs that comment on familiar tropes. These films reward rewatching because the jokes reveal new details on subsequent views. Netflix tends to keep a stable core of these titles while refreshing peripheral picks to match seasonal viewing trends.

Practical Ways to Find Funny Movies on Netflix
Use built-in filters, search tricks, and category deep dives to cut through clutter and surface comedies that suit your taste. The goal is not to chase every new addition, but to identify reliable clusters of humor that match how you like to watch.
Search Patterns That Work
- Search by broad genre, then narrow with mood keywords such as sharp, gentle, offbeat, or family-friendly.
- Sort within comedy categories by popularity or Top 10 to see titles with strong, sustained audience engagement.
- Add simple genre or tone notes to your searches, like workplace comedy or satire, to surface relevant results faster.
Browse Categories Intentionally
Netflix organizes movies into multiple comedy buckets, including comedies, parodies, and satires. Combine exploration of these categories with sorting by popularity to identify picks that survive algorithm shifts and temporary trends.
Evaluating Rewatch Value and Humor Style
Not all laughs are equal. Movies built on timing, character, and clever dialogue typically age better than those dependent on rapid-fire references or short-term cultural moments. When in doubt, prioritize films with strong writing credits and clear genre commitments over loosely branded comedies.
